A Dual-Channel Class-D Amplifier with SIP, Dante, and ONVIF Support
The ZYCOO SD Series Network Power Amplifiers — comprising the SD260 and SD2140 — are purpose-built for commercial audio applications, including corporate offices, hospitality venues, retail spaces, and educational facilities, leveraging advanced Class-D amplification technology to deliver crystal-clear audio and outstanding reliability.
Both models support constant voltage (100V/70V) and constant impedance speaker configurations. The SD260 delivers 2 × 60W or 1 × 120W (bridged), while the SD2140 offers higher output at 2 × 140W or 1 × 280W (bridged). Each model features a versatile range of inputs, including balanced/unbalanced line, Bluetooth, and network sources. With compatibility for SIP, Dante, and ONVIF protocols — no additional modules required — they offer a comprehensive, feature-rich solution.
Darüber hinaus sind die Verstärker mit einem in Echtzeit einstellbaren Mischer und einem Equalizer ausgestattet und unterstützen die zeitgesteuerte Wiedergabe über USB , wodurch sie sich ideal für skalierbare, intelligente Audioinstallationen eignen.
